About Flanders Elementary School
Flanders Elementary School is a small public elementary school located in the remote town of Malone, New York. Serving students from pre-kindergarten through fifth grade, Flanders has an enrollment of 224 students and maintains a low student-teacher ratio of 9:1 with 25 full-time equivalent teachers on staff. The school’s setting is in a quiet, rural area where the community values close-knit relationships and local traditions.
Despite its modest academic score of 1.6 out of 10 and state ranking at #4315 among 4758 New York schools (9th percentile), Flanders Elementary focuses on student development beyond test scores. Only 27% of students are proficient in ELA/Reading, while just 19% meet proficiency standards in Math, indicating areas for improvement but also highlighting the school's commitment to growth and personalized learning. Performance Trends
Math proficiency has declined from 32% (2019) to 17% (2021). Reading/ELA proficiency has improved from 22% (2019) to 27% (2021).

Community Profile
The community surrounding Flanders Elementary School has a median household income of $64,673. It is a community where 23%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$123,100, with a median rent of $821/month. The area has a poverty rate of 12.4%. Residents enjoy a short average commute of 16 minutes.
